>>> Even though the current xserver in oe-core (1.13) doesn't ship these as
>>> standalone extensions, older X servers required by binary drives
>>> (e.g. meta-intel's 1.9) still install them separately.  As the packages didn't
>>> exist in xserver-xorg.inc the extensions were not packaged, and X didn't work.
>>>
>>> Revolve this by restoring the package definitions, and moving the upgrade path
>>> dependencies to xserver-xorg_1.13.bb.
